#113037 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#113037 is composed of 6.7% red, 18.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 191.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 14.1%. #113037 color hex could be obtained by blending #22606e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#113037 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#113037 has RGB values of R:17, G:48,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 1126455.

Shades and Tints of #113037
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090a is the darkest color, while #fafd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#113037
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222626 is the less saturated color, while #003a48 is the most saturated one.
